/*

		character_popularity_vote_2nd	main.css
		last update 2005/10/28 (fri)

*/

body	{ margin: 0px; padding: 0px; }
p		{ font-size: 12px; color: #333; line-height: 180%; margin: 0px; padding: 0px; }
p.para	{ margin: 0px 30px; }
p.title	{ font-size: 14px; color: #FFF; line-height: 180%; font-weight: bold; background: #009933; padding-left: 10px; }
p.name	{ font-size: 10px; color: #05481c; line-height: 160%; }
p.copy	{ font-size: 12px; color: #336633; line-height: 200%; }
p.attention	{ margin: 0px 40px; padding: 20px; text-align: left; border: 1px solid #666; }


a		{ font-size: 12px; color: #489148; line-height: 180%; text-decoration: none; }
a:hover	{ font-size: 12px; color: #489148; line-height: 180%; text-decoration: underline; }


#vdisp			{ width: 653px; margin: 60px auto; text-align: left; }
#content		{ background: repeat-y url(../img/bg.jpg); padding-bottom: 20px; }
div.paragraph	{ width: 600px; padding: 10px 0px; text-align: left; }
div.paragraph_c	{ width: 600px; padding: 25px 0px; text-align: center; }
div.chara1-3	{ width: 600px; padding: 10px; text-align:center; }
div.chara1-3 div{ float: left;  margin-bottom: 15px; }
*html div.chara1-3 div{ float: left; }
div.chara4-6	{ width: 600px; padding: 6px; text-align:center; margin-top: 15px;  }
div.chara7-10	{ width: 600px; padding: 4px; text-align:center; margin-bottom: 23px; }
div.box1		{ width: 110px; height: 17px; float:left; display: inline; background-color:#009933; font-size:12px; font-weight:bold; color:#FFFFFF; margin: 10px 3px 3px; padding-top:4px; }
div.box2		{ width: 110px; height: 17px; float:left; display: inline; background-color:#FFFFFF; font-size:10px; margin: 3px 3px 10px; padding-top: 4px; }
div.table		{ width: 600px; margin: 13px 0px 0px; text-align:center; margin: 0px; display: table; }
img.mg1			{ margin: 0px 30px; }
img.mg2			{ margin: 0px 24px; }
img.mg3			{ margin: 0px 12px; }
.m5			{ margin: 5px 0px; }
.m15		{ margin: 31px 0px 5px 0px; }
.attention	{ width: 430px; text-align: left; padding: 15px 0px; }
span.red	{ color: #FF3333; }

/* vote */

#vote			{ margin-right: 15px; }
div.voteContent	{ margin: 0px 50px 0px 35px; padding: 15px 0px; }
.icon			{ margin-bottom: 5px; }
.icon img		{ margin: 0px 20px; }
input			{ margin: 10px; }

/* end */
.end		{ font-size: 16px ; color:#990000 ; font-weight: bold ; }